A customer who stayed at this hotel wrote this review.
Purpose of trip was to have a leisurely break so hotel location was excellent for Oxford Street shopping as well as for buses and underground connections to explore other parts of London. Quite a hike but a walkable distance if required from Piccadilly and Leicester Square. Hotel foyer, bar and restaurant was very smart but the bedrooms were not quite in the same league and fairly small, but not in the room much anyway. Lovely, very helpful staff. Spent a really interesting few hours at the Imperial War Musuem, but it was the English schools half term break which was bad timing as many places were extremely hectic with up to 90 minutes queue for the Natural History Musuem so didn't wait for that. Enjoyed Covent Garden for a wander around and had dinner in Chinatown on two nights.

A customer who stayed at this hotel wrote this review.
Mostyn Hotel excellent value for money. Rooms a little small, but we spent so little time in them, it didn't matter. Breakfast excellent, choice of cooked freshly prepared. Bar, reception area and resaurant in excellent condition, and staff very friendly and helpful. Highly recommended. If looking for nearby restaurants, walk to St Christopher's place which is just behind Oxford Street (next to Selfridges) It's a real gem, most people going to London probably don't know it's there. Try Sofra (middle eastern cuisine) or Carluccio's (Italian).
